"In SHARP, David Fitzpatrick is our tour guide for a harrowing journey from self-destructive psychosis to a cautious reemergence into the flickering sunshine of the sane world. Fitzpatrick writes about mental illness with the unsparing intensity of Sylvia Plath and Anne Sexton, but also with the hard-won self-knowledge of William Styron, Kay Jamison, and other chroniclers of disease, recovery and management. While reading Sharp, I was at turns frightened, appalled, enlightened and overcome with sadness. Throughout I was fully engaged, and by the book's end, reassured about the triumph of the human spirit and the healing power of a family's patient and abiding love. For those of us who seek a better understanding of mental illness, David Fitzpatrick's Sharp is a must-read, remarkably told."---Wally Lamb.
